In public relations and communication theory, a public is distinct from a stakeholder or a market. A public is a subset of the set of stakeholders for an organization, that comprises those people concerned with a specific issue. You can think of feedback-seeking behavior as referring to how individuals seek feedback either by reading the actions of others to infer what it means – in other words, to get feedback purely through observation, or by explicitly asking others for feedback. In general, feedback systems can have many signals fed back, and the feedback loops frequently contain mixtures of positive and negative feedback where positive and negative feedback can dominate at different frequencies or different points in the state space of a system. At its core, feedback is information about the result of an action that shapes what happens next. It shows up in biology, engineering, communication, learning, and everyday conversation, and understanding how it works in each of these areas gives you a much clearer picture of the world.
